Back in February I volunteered a day on a Habitat for Humanity project in Morgan Hill. Today I visited again to shoot final photos of the homes before the dedication this weekend. Over 3000 volunteers donated their time to the six townhomes on the site, over more than 18 months. Again I urge you to volunteer as part of a group, or individually on any Habitat project. The next one in this area is being started very soon in Cupertino.
